: Hi, is there anyone who is familiar with GFP/EGFP(Green
: Fluorescent Protein,
: living color series from Clontech)? I wanna clearify the
: followings before
: I try it.
: 1)How long does it take for GFP to be expressed/become
: fluorescent?
: (I am looking for sth that can be expressed instantly/within
: few mins
: once the constructs are introduced into cells)

Normally it takes 3-5 hours after transfection to express enough GFP protein
in cells to get detectable fluorescence. Another trick is that it will take
about 3 hours for the fluorophore on GFP to be oxidized so that it can be
fluorescent. As far as I know, the quickest detection of GFP (or other
living fluorescent variants from Clontech) is around 8 hours after
introduction of DNA. The earliest time I ever tried is 10 hours after
transfection, but it is weak.

However, if you really want to see the fluorescence quick, you may try
introduce mRNA, instead of DNA, into the cells (by electroporation etc.).
It should be much quicker, but still not in the range of minutes.

: 2)does it need incubation?
: (I do in situ single cell lever gene introduction, can't
: incubate on site
: at this stage)

Don't quite understand ur question. But I guess it doesn't need incubation
since it is the so called "living color protein" which means you can see
the fluorescence even in live cells (withou any treatment).

: Suggestions on other kind of vectors are also highly
: appreciated.

Heard about some other vectors, such as Super Cylone GFP. But none of them
are as good as pEGFP from Clontech. I have 2 suggestions for you:
1. try making a inducible construct. It may produce protein quicker upon
induction.
2. Try place multiple GFP coding sequence into your construct. By this way
the fluorescense should be much stronger and be visible faster.
